Output fca19cd85fc50d62d78e7d1805ef7783da384cee3f80ec1467c4bd78ecc5b8bb:1

value
872170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23583eda9f59c2a1cb9433b47a61f5457f92f860 OP_EQUAL
address
34uuHfUsths7kxET91weCtu21yyRiMpVzE
transaction
fca19cd85fc50d62d78e7d1805ef7783da384cee3f80ec1467c4bd78ecc5b8bb
confirmations
281474
spent
true